It was called El Amigo. In the 1970s the Ishii Family sold the store to the Miyoshi family. Left behind in the store was a warehouse full of family photos, correspondences and other memorabilia. Numerous attempts were made by the Miyoshi family to return the personal items, but the Ishii family did not want them. \r\n\r\nChuhei \"Charles\" and Futaba (Nakajima) married in 1915 and had 3 sons, Robert, Tom, and Calvin. Tom went to Japan where he was enrolled in college before the war. Robert was attending Stanford University while Calvin was still in high school. Chuhei was arrested on December 13, 1941 and transferred to Tuna Canyon, then Fort Missoula, next Fort Sill, and finally Santa Fe. On Sept. 2, 1943 Chuhei was deported to Japan. Robert, Calvin and their mother Futaba were detained at Gila River. Calvin and Futaba were deported to Japan in June of 1943, while Robert stayed in the US and left Gila River in 1944 for Philadelphia. In 1955 Chuhei and Futaba returned to the United States. Futaba gained citizenship in 1961. Chuhei passed in 1972, Futaba in 1989, and Robert in 1980. No death records were located for Calvin and Tom, according information provided by the lender and found in Ancestry they may passed while conscripted in the Japanese Army.","relatedmaterial":"Toru Miyoshi Family Collection (ddr-densho-480)","search_hidden":"","download_large":"ddr-densho-546-3-mezzanine-8375bb4859-a.jpg"}
